Puma’s Strategic Turnaround: A Buy Rating Amidst Brand Cycle Reset and Valuation Opportunities

Puma’s Strategic Turnaround: A Buy Rating Amidst Brand Cycle Reset and Valuation Opportunities

Bernstein analyst William Woods maintained a Buy rating on PUMA SE NPV today and set a price target of €24.00.

William Woods has given his Buy rating due to a combination of factors that suggest Puma is at a pivotal moment in its brand cycle. Despite facing challenges after years of growth, the arrival of a new CEO has led to strategic decisions aimed at resetting expectations, which Woods views as a positive step. Although there is anticipated volatility in the short term, the potential for a favorable risk/reward scenario is evident, as reflected in the stock’s current valuation compared to its peers.
Woods believes that Puma’s strong brand history provides a solid foundation for a successful turnaround, with early indications of renewed brand interest, particularly in the running segment. The stock’s valuation on an EV/Sales basis suggests it is nearing the bottom, offering an attractive entry point for investors. The primary concern remains the inventory clearance cycle, but Woods is optimistic about the new CEO’s strategic focus, which could enhance the company’s performance and positively impact the stock price.
